Abstract
An optical connector has an optical waveguide slit and a pass-through hole. The optical waveguide slit is a hole that extends from an insertion surface of a connector body into the connector body. The optical waveguide slit accommodates a sheet-like optical waveguide whose tip abuts against a slit bottom. The pass-through hole is provided near the slit bottom, and passes through the top surface of the connector body and the top surface of the optical waveguide slit.
